I looked at several trains on the website before I chose Learning Locomotive. I decided on this one because it didn't have a track. I thought for the age of my granddaughter (19 months) that this \choo choo\" as she calls it would allow the best learning experience. She can build her train on a table or the floor and move it along without the frustration of trying to keep it on a track. When she is a bit older she would probably like a train on a track. I also liked this train because it allows for the chid to create their train in many different ways - a different train every time! At 19 months my granddaughter could easily manage getting the blocks onto the train car pegs - except the 'diagonal' blocks were still difficult for her to line up on the pegs. So she would just set those on top of another block! I also loved the durability of the wooden pieces.
